I have a 4-bar drum loop on pad 1, one sample on pad 2, a different sample on pad 3 & copied to pad 4, and another different sample on pad 6.

I have no trouble with pad 1 cutting out when I play it with the other pads, but when I begin to record, pad 1 stops when I hit pad 3 - sometimes after pad 4 (before the 4-bars are complete). The order I'm trying to record is 1 (playing throughout) + 2 -> 3 -> 4 -> 6

I've tried to resample the samples without the drums and play that along with the drum loop, but the arrangement of the resample is not in the order I recorded in.

It doesn't matter if I take gate or loop off the drum loop, it just stops (even when I'm holding pad 1). Has this happened to anyone else? I'd be more than okay with posting a video if it would help.
